The below graph shows the average detached house price in the East Cambridgeshire local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The two 21 ASTLEY CLOSE sales from July 1995 and May 2007 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the July 1995 sale was for 6% above the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 6% above the HPI over time, until the May 2007 sale, where it falls to 16% below the HPI. The line then continues to track at 16% below the HPI.

21 ASTLEY CLOSE sits on a plot of roughly 0.086 of an acre, or 349m². The below map shows the location of 21 ASTLEY CLOSE, an approximate outline of the building(s), and the indicative extent of the property. The plot extent is a Land Registry INSPIRE Index Polygon, and it is important to note that a title may include more than one polygon, whereas only one polygon is shown on the map (the polygon which intersects with the position of 21 ASTLEY CLOSE). The full extent of the land contained in any registered title can only be identified from the individual title plan. The maps on this page should not be relied upon to establish the extent of a title.
